I have a freeze alarm in my house and it works great except for one problem. The phone line the freeze alarm communicates via is a cable line and when the electricity fails, the cable modem goes off and it needs to be re-set manually. Thus, after a power failure the freeze alarm can be off for long stretches of time until someone goes to the house and resets the cable modem. Is the only solution to this problem to invest in a land line?

Thanks
You could also invest in a self charging external battery backup. They can cost upwards of $100, but you'll have peace of mind when the powers out. Just plug the cable modem into the back up battery and depending on the size you buy, you could run the cable modem and freeze alarm for several day or even weeks (let's hope not) without power.
